We present a study of ionospheric convection patterns observed by the Super Dual Auroral Radar Network (SuperDARN) during two recent steady magnetospheric convection (SMC) events. Our analyses foucus on the region near the Harang discontinuity (HD) and show, in contrast to prevous SMC studies, that the HD is not an uncommon feature during SMC events. Although often observed during these events, the HD appears less extended than during a typical substorm growth phase and often forms at relatively high geomagnetic latitudes.
